By Doug Miller / New Orleans Saints.Com

For the second consecutive week the New Orleans Saints (2-0) met a NFC foe and rolled to a convincing victory. Today’s opponent, the Philadelphia Eagles (1-1), had pulled to within four points of the Saints at the half, 17-13, but the Saints exploded for two touchdowns within four minutes of each other to start the second half and never looked back, winning 48-22.

“I think it was a big win for us in all three phases of the game,” said Head Coach Sean Payton after the game. “We made at least one big play on special teams, led by the forced fumble to start the second half that took it from a four point lead to an 11 point lead.”

Payton continued, saying, “This is a very good team we played today and this is a really tough place to play. I think looking back on it, I would say that the turnover battle was probably the deciding factor in the game today.”
